A mixed valence manganese triangle in a trigonal lattice: structure and magnetism

Abstract

The synthesis, structural and magnetic characterisation of trinuclear manganese cluster, [Mn3O(O2C-anth)6(HOCH3)3] 1 (where O2C-anth = 9-anthracenecarboxylate), with crystallographic three-fold (C3) symmetry, are described. The cluster was prepared by a carboxylate exchange reaction between HO2C-anth and [Mn12O12(O2CMe)16(H2O)4] with concomitant fragmentation of the dodecanuclear Mn core of the starting material to form a trinuclear Mn33-O) cluster capped by six carboxylate ligands. Bond valence sum calculations and SQUID magnetometric measurements establish the oxidation states of the metal ions as MnII·2 MnIII which are antiferromagnetically coupled.
